How they compare
Belarus currently reports 8,106 constant LCU per person against 7,547 constant LCU per person in Bolivia, a difference of 559 constant LCU per person.
That makes Belarus's figure about 1.1 times Bolivia's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Bolivia ahead.
Belarus ranks 115th and Bolivia ranks 118th of 198 countries.
Bolivia has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Belarus | Bolivia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 1,975 constant LCU per person | 4,758 constant LCU per person | 2,783 constant LCU per person | Bolivia |
| 2000s | 3,838 constant LCU per person | 5,669 constant LCU per person | 1,831 constant LCU per person | Bolivia |
| 2010s | 6,834 constant LCU per person | 7,936 constant LCU per person | 1,102 constant LCU per person | Bolivia |
| 2020s | 7,386 constant LCU per person | 7,591 constant LCU per person | 204.27 constant LCU per person | Bolivia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Industry (including construction), value added (constant LCU)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
